Eltek PowerSuite 3.3 is a configuration and monitoring application designed for Compack, Smartpack, and Smartpack2-based DC power supply systems. To download the software and its associated tools, you can use the Eltek Network Utility (ENU), which simplifies the administration of Eltek products with IP network connectivity, including firmware updates and system configurations. Key Features of PowerSuite 3.3

Comprehensive Monitoring: Offers a unified interface to monitor and control system parameters such as alarms, battery testing, and temperature compensation.

Advanced Battery Management: Includes automated discharge testing, battery tables, and "Special Monitors" for estimating remaining capacity and lifetime.

Flexible Connectivity: Supports local connection via USB (requires the Eltek USB to UART driver 6.1 or later) or remote access through Ethernet LAN using UDP tunneling.

System Configuration: Version 3.3 introduced improved battery symmetry controls, password protection for I/O monitors, and expanded data logging functionality. Installation Guide

Download the Installer: Obtain the PowerSuite installation files via the Eltek Network Utility or from official vendor sites like Advice.co.il.

Install Drivers First: Warning: Do not connect the USB cable to your PC before installing the application and drivers.

Run the Wizard: Execute the setup file and follow the PowerSuite Install Wizard. If prompted, install or upgrade the Eltek USB to UART driver 6.1 (essential for Windows 7 and 64-bit systems).

Hardware Connection: Once the software is installed, power on the Smartpack controller and connect the USB cable. Windows should detect the device automatically. Eltek Power Suite 3

Finalize: Restart your computer if prompted by Windows after the driver installation is complete. System Requirements

Operating System: Compatible with Windows XP, Vista, 7, 8, and 10.

Prerequisites: Requires Microsoft .NET Framework 4.8 (x86 or x64) for the latest versions of the Network Utility.

Hardware: Minimum 1 GHz CPU, 512 MB RAM, and at least 850 MB of free hard drive space. Eltek Network Utility

Eltek Power Suite is the centralized configuration and monitoring platform designed for Eltek’s power supply systems. It allows engineers to communicate with controllers (specifically the Smartpack and Smartpack S controllers) to optimize performance, diagnose faults, and manage energy consumption.

Unlike generic monitoring tools, Power Suite is proprietary software that speaks the specific protocol language of Eltek hardware. It transforms raw data from the rectifiers into actionable intelligence, allowing for the adjustment of float voltages, temperature compensation curves, and alarm thresholds.
